Mich. Can Bar Schools From Collecting Union Dues: 6th Circ.

By Sindhu Sundar (May 9, 2013, 5:28 PM EDT) -- The Sixth Circuit on Thursday gave Michigan the green light to block public schools from deducting union dues from employees' payroll, finding the law doesn't violate the First Amendment because the Constitution guarantees only free speech, not the use of government processes to collect funds for that speech....
